Stutthof was a German Nazi concentration camp established near the village of Stutthof (now Sztutowo) in the territory of the German-annexed Free City of Danzig. It was the first German concentration camp set up outside German borders during World War II and was the last camp liberated by the Allies on 9 May 1945.
